Class of 1962 holds reunion
Oct 05, 2012 | 893 views | 0 0 comments | 1 1 recommendations | email to a friend | print

The 1962 class of Winnsboro High School held their 50th anniversary reunion on Aug. 18.

There was a cookout at Fortune Springs Park at noon and an evening event at Honeysuckle Acres Bed and Breakfast.

A great time was reportedly had by all.

Forty-one classmates and five teachers attended. The classmates attending were Sam Arnette, Kay Bass Black, Glenda Bolen Clifton, Faye Branham, Keith Brewington, Anne Brown Rogers, Billy Castles, Carolyn Clyburn Brown, Joyce Coleman Wilson, Helen Collins, Vicki Dark Dodds, Pat Denton LeGrand, Paul Dove, Sam Edenfield, Buck Ellison, Jamie Frazier, Henry Gerald, Spencer Hewitt, Bobby Johnson, Susan Lyles Randall, Lucinda Martin Shirley, Ted McDonald, John McMaster, Jerome Mincey, Becky Motes Dougherty, Ted Nichols, Randy Perry Sears, Jeannie Ramsey Montgomery, Patty Rutland Cathcart, Patsy Shaw Caldwell, Brenda Stevenson Gause, Martha Stevenson Jones, John Taylor, Mary Jo Turner Byrd, Donald Walker, Robbie Walker Wilson, Larry Waters, Brenda Weed Snyder, Johnny Ray Wilson, Theron Wilson, and Tommy Griggs. Teachers attending were Rand Foster, Betty Lutz, Selwyn Turner, Martha Westbrook Conder, and Lola Dove.

The group also remembered classmates who are no longer with us.

They include Wayne Sumner, John Henry Lewis, Derrell Mixon, Steve Hilton, Doug Buchanan, Johnny Carter, Leslie Clark, Oscar Collins, Libby Denton, Reginald McPhatter, Tina Powers, Verna Reynolds Nichols, Walter Rutland, Barbara Smith, Marie Starnes, and Mary Barkley Turner.
